> This is non-backward-compatible and introduces a possibility that
> tested-on-non-rt userspace will fail on -rt kernels.  It might be
> better to accept the writes, but to ignore them.  Probably with a
> pr_warn_once() to let people know what we did.

Hmm.

> But do we really need to take the option away from -rt users?  Perhaps
> someone wants this feature and can accept the latency hit.  How about
> switching the default and otherwise leaving the kernel behaviour as-is
> and simply emitting a warning letting -rt users know that they might
> not want to enable this?

I don't think that RT people can live with the latency spike. The
problem is that it is not deterministic in terms *when* it happens and
*how*long* does it need to complete. Also it is not visible so you end
up with additional 100us and you have no idea why.
compaction is "okay" in the setup / configuration phase when the mlock()
pages aren't around / the RT task is disabled. So it does not disturb
the RT load.

Allowing the user to change the knob and spitting a warning is probably
good. So we have a preferred default and the user is aware if it is
changed with or without his knowledge.
